當 AI 在開發過程中出錯時,開發者直接修改並讓 AI 學習修正的機制,將如何影響開發團隊的迭代速度和程式碼品質?
Answer
AI 修正機制對開發團隊迭代速度的影響
當 AI 在開發過程中犯錯時,開發者可以直接修改並讓 AI 學習修正,這種機制顯著提升了開發團隊的迭代速度。傳統上,程式碼出錯需要開發者花時間Debug、修改並重新測試,而 AI 學習修正的機制可以快速修正錯誤,縮短了除錯和測試的時間。Google 的 Antigravity 等 AI 驅動的 IDE 能儲存最佳解決方案和程式碼片段,未來遇到類似問題時,AI 可以更快地解決,進一步加速迭代過程。
AI 修正機制對程式碼品質的影響
AI 學習修正的機制不僅加速了迭代,也有助於提升程式碼品質。AI 在開發過程中犯錯並被修正後,會從錯誤中學習,避免未來再次犯同樣的錯誤。這種持續學習和修正的過程,有助於建立更穩定、更可靠的程式碼庫。此外,AI 能夠自主提交任務清單、計畫和測試截圖,驗證其工作成果,增強開發者對 AI 的信任,確保程式碼品質。
AI 修正機制的潛在挑戰
儘管 AI 學習修正機制帶來了許多好處,但也存在一些潛在挑戰。開發者需要確保 AI 從錯誤中學習的方式是正確的,避免 AI 學到錯誤的模式或偏見。此外,開發團隊需要建立有效的監控和驗證機制,確保 AI 的修正不會引入新的問題。AI 在修正錯誤時可能會產生意想不到的副作用,需要開發者仔細評估和處理。